Output 2c66f821860324a9aafb84bbfbade499fb07e29ee48c9c58836e9c086abe5783:1

value
73438463
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ba2ef1d7418bf6d6bbe702a20225b29a2c94ef4 OP_EQUALVERIFY OP_CHECKSIG
address
14yjF74XNshAjfmxNicS1PWu6ahzs3RQii
transaction
2c66f821860324a9aafb84bbfbade499fb07e29ee48c9c58836e9c086abe5783
confirmations
299117
spent
true